Understanding Low-Pressure Steam Systems
Low-pressure steam systems are essential components in various industrial applications and can significantly enhance energy efficiency, improve process control, and reduce operational costs. These systems typically operate at pressures below 15 psi, making them ideal for applications where high temperature and steam quality are not critical.
One of the primary advantages of low-pressure steam systems is their ability to provide a reliable source of heat. They are widely used in heating applications, including space heating, process heating, and sterilization in industries such as food processing, pharmaceuticals, and textiles. The lower pressure allows for a broader range of temperature control, making it suitable for delicate processes requiring consistent temperature regulation.
The components of a low-pressure steam system include a boiler, steam traps, pressure regulators, piping, and heat exchangers. The boiler generates steam by heating water, typically using natural gas, oil, or electricity. It's crucial to maintain the boiler’s efficiency through regular maintenance, such as cleaning and inspecting for corrosion or wear.
Steam traps play a vital role in the system by removing condensate and non-condensable gases while preventing the loss of live steam
. Proper selection and installation of steam traps can lead to significant energy savings and extend the life of the steam system.Despite the benefits, low-pressure steam systems also have their challenges. Common issues include improper steam distribution, leading to insufficient heating in some areas, and steam leaks, which can result in energy losses. Implementing regular maintenance schedules and monitoring system performance can mitigate these problems.
Furthermore, operators must be trained to understand the intricacies of low-pressure steam systems. Knowledge about steam quality, pressure maintenance, and troubleshooting can significantly impact system efficiency.
In conclusion, low-pressure steam systems play a crucial role in a wide range of industrial processes by providing efficient and controllable heating. Their design and operation require careful planning and maintenance to maximize their benefits. With the right approach, industries can utilize low-pressure steam systems not only to enhance productivity but also to contribute to energy conservation efforts and sustainability goals.
